Presentation at Open Repositories 2014, Helsinki, Finland, June 9-13, 2014 Invenio Interest Group Presentations Invenio was originally developed at CERN in 2002 to run the CERN Document Server, managing today around 1.5M records. Invenio is now an open source software package which provides tools to manage digital assets in large scale digital and web driven document repositories. Its scope covers all aspects of document management from document ingestion through classification, indexing, and curation to dissemination and preservation. After introducing Invenio the paper will describe a practical approach to implement solutions for diverse aspects of document management at CERN. Examples will include the use of Invenio in e-procurement processes at CERN, electronic Bulletins, announcements of conferences and on-line events (data streaming), archives and preservation of multimedia assets. Features and particular uses of workflow, ranking, access rights restrictions will also be addressed, in particular in the e-procurement case. Invenio at CERN serves a wide variety of electronic documents (including articles, books, journals, photos) and multimedia content such as pictures, presentations, talks, posters, plots, audio podcasts and videos. |
